pub struct EnergyConsumption {
pub id: String,
pub entity_id: String,
pub facility_id: String,
pub period: NaiveDate,
pub energy_source: EnergySourceType,
pub consumption_kwh: Decimal,
pub cost: Decimal,
pub currency: String,
pub is_renewable: bool,
}Expand description
Energy consumption record for a facility in a period.
